Taline Papazian

Taline Papazian is a political scientist. She has published and taught at various universities in France and in the United States. She specializes in post-Soviet armed conflicts, with a particular focus on state and non-state military institutions and actors in Armenia. In addition to lecturing and publishing, she manages the nonprofit “Armenia Peace Initiative,” an organization promoting sustainable peace in the South Caucasus via enhancement of human security. Taline currently teaches at Sciences Po, in Aix en provence, and at the Ecole de l'Air.

After Defeat: Lessons From Marc Bloch

What can a French historian's account of his country's collapse in 1940 reveal about Armenia after the 2020 war? Taline Papazian revisits Marc Bloch's “Strange Defeat” to examine leadership, society, resistance and the difficult work of national self-reflection and rebuilding.
